i know some stores have mats that are cut like puzzle pieces, a basic square with interlocking sides.  this would give you the option of having a padded floor that absorbs sound, is easily replacable, and if nothing else, you can take it out in the yard and hose the pieces down. 

cork is a wonderful accoustic deadener, and will also insulate floors if you go with cork floor tiles.  if you've never been in an accoustically sound room, its a bit of a mindfuck to NOT have the slight echoes that most rooms with hard walls have.  it gives you the sensation that you constantly need to "pop" your ears too.
